Output 5db339b23270143369b69ee588a438214ec0db434bd4f2bd5b67896c094e5e1e:0

value
644524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0751d503392ab9751db72ea0c7f95d5ec208f573 OP_EQUAL
address
32MiggM4YSmeHYG55UMCBRxVdyE7oxNSvZ
transaction
5db339b23270143369b69ee588a438214ec0db434bd4f2bd5b67896c094e5e1e
spent
true